Christian Ed, Youth departments to host skills building conference September 30

SOUTH CANAAN, PA [OCA Communications]Saint Tikhon’s Monastery and Seminary here will be the site of a skills building conference, “Equipping the Saints: Building Skills for Education and Youth Ministries,” on Saturday, September 30, 2006.

With the blessing of His Beatitude, Metropolitan Herman, the conference is being sponsored by the OCA Departments of Christian Education and Youth, Young Adult, and Campus Ministries, in partnership with the Diocese of Eastern Pennsylvania. The conference is geared specifically for teachers, youth ministers, clergy, and lay persons.

Presenters and workshop leaders will include Mrs. Valerie Zahirsky, Mrs. Myra Kovalak, and other DCE members; Deacon Joseph Matusiak, Youth Department director; the Very Rev. David Mahaffey; and other department members.

In addition to keynote presentations on the conference theme, several individual workshop sessions will be offered. Topics will include ways to develop parish youth ministries “from scratch,” the “welcoming classroom,” making the distinction between youth ministry and youth activity, curriculum resources and planning, and discerning effective teaching methods.

A variety of displays highlighting the many educational resources available for parish use will also be available.
